Owlet, Inc. reported earnings results for the first quarter ended March 31, 2024. For the first quarter, the company reported sales was USD 14.8 million compared to USD 10.7 million a year ago. Net income was USD 3.3 million compared to net loss of USD 11.9 million a year ago.
Owlet, Inc. operates as a digital parenting platform company. The Company's platform focuses on giving real-time data and insights to parents. Its products include Owlet Dream Sock, an app to assist children with better sleep; Owlet Cam, a video streaming app to hear and see the baby from anywhere, and Owlet Monitor Duo. The Company offers sock monitor offerings, which include Smart Sock and Dream Sock and Dream Sock Plus. Its Cam offerings include Cam 1 and Cam 2. Its Monitor Duo and Dream Duo offer Sock Monitor offerings paired with the Owlet Cam offerings, combining the intelligence of its Sock Monitor offerings with high-definition video, offering parents the most complete picture of their babyâs sleep. Its accessories product line includes the Owlet Sleeper, a wearable rayon blanket that encourages safe sleep, best for babies ages three-six months old, and an Owlet Sock Travel Case.
